Chocolate Bourbon Pecan Pie with Bacon Recipe

Ingredients:

  • 1 pre-made pie crust (or homemade, if preferred)
  • 3 large eggs
  • 1 cup light corn syrup
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/4 cup dark brown sugar
  • 2 tablespoons bourbon
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
  • 1/2 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• 1 1/2 cups pecans, roughly chopped
  • 4 slices cooked bacon, crumbled

Instructions:

  1. Preheat the Oven:
    •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Roll out the pie crust and fit it into a 9-inch pie dish.
  2. Prepare the Filling:
    • In a large bowl, whisk together the eggs, corn syrup, granulated sugar, brown sugar, bourbon, vanilla extract, and melted butter until smooth.
  3. Add the Mix-Ins:
    • Stir in the chocolate chips, chopped pecans, and crumbled bacon.
  4. Assemble the Pie:
    • Pour the filling into the prepared pie crust, spreading it evenly.
  5. Bake:
    • Place the pie on a baking sheet and bake for 50-60 minutes, or until the filling is set and the top is golden brown. If the edges of the crust brown too quickly, cover them with aluminum foil.
  6. Cool and Serve:
    • Let the pie cool completely before slicing to allow the filling to set. Serve as is or with a dollop of whipped cream.

Tips for Perfect Chocolate Bourbon Pecan Pie with Bacon

  • Bacon Variations: Use maple or candied bacon for an added layer of sweetness.
  • Bourbon Substitutes: If bourbon isn’t your preference, try rum or omit the alcohol for a kid-friendly version.
  • Make Ahead: This pie can be made a day in advance and stored in the refrigerator.
  • Pairing Suggestions: Enjoy with a scoop of vanilla ice cream or a glass of bourbon for a full-flavored experience.
